Understanding the Celsius and Fahrenheit Scales



Before diving into the conversion, it's beneficial to grasp the differences between the Celsius and Fahrenheit scales. Celsius, also known as Centigrade, is based on the freezing and boiling points of water at 0°C and 100°C respectively. Fahrenheit, on the other hand, sets the freezing point of water at 32°F and the boiling point at 212°F. This difference in reference points necessitates a conversion formula to accurately translate temperatures between the two scales.

The Conversion Formula: From Celsius to Fahrenheit



The fundamental formula for converting Celsius (°C) to Fahrenheit (°F) is:

°F = (°C × 9/5) + 32

This formula highlights the inherent relationship between the two scales. The factor 9/5 accounts for the difference in the scale's range (100°C versus 180°F), while adding 32 adjusts for the different zero points.

Step-by-Step Conversion of 66°C to Fahrenheit



Now, let's apply this formula to convert 66°C to Fahrenheit:

Step 1: Multiply the Celsius temperature by 9/5:

66°C × 9/5 = 118.8°

Step 2: Add 32 to the result:

118.8° + 32° = 150.8°F

Therefore, 66°C is equivalent to 150.8°F.

Common Challenges and Troubleshooting



While the conversion formula is straightforward, some common challenges can arise:

Fractions and Decimals: The 9/5 fraction can lead to decimal results. It's important to understand that these decimals represent fractional degrees and are perfectly valid within the context of temperature measurements. Rounding should be done appropriately based on the required precision.

Order of Operations: Remember to follow the order of operations (PEMDAS/BODMAS). Multiply before adding. Failure to do so will result in an incorrect answer.

Negative Temperatures: The formula works equally well for negative Celsius temperatures. Just remember to carefully handle the arithmetic with negative numbers. For instance, converting -10°C to Fahrenheit: (-10°C × 9/5) + 32 = 14°F

Unit Confusion: Always double-check that you're working with Celsius and are applying the correct formula. Confusing the units can lead to significant errors.

FAQs



1. Can I use a calculator for the conversion? Yes, using a calculator significantly simplifies the process, particularly for more complex conversions or when dealing with decimals.

2. What if I need to convert Fahrenheit to Celsius? The reverse conversion formula is: °C = (°F - 32) × 5/9

3. Is there a significant difference between 150.8°F and 151°F? The difference is minor (0.2°F) and may not be significant in many contexts. However, the level of precision required depends on the application.

4. How accurate does my conversion need to be? The required accuracy depends on the context. For cooking, a slightly rounded-off number might suffice. For scientific experiments, greater precision is typically necessary.
